Tammy Pahel, Kathryn Moore and Anni Hood to headline World Halotherapy Symposium
By Megan Whitby 06 Dec 2021
With its respiratory and antimicrobial properties, salt- or halo-therapy has been tipped as a key wellness trend in light of Covid-19 Credit: Shutterstock/Peakstock
The two-day World Halotherapy Symposium will go live tomorrow on 7 December to encourage the convergence of the halotherapy and wellness industries.

The free virtual conference is hosted by industry body the World Halotherapy Association (WHA) and has already attracted interest from nearly 500 registrants across 17 countries.

The WHA is a physician-backed association formed to ensure a global standard of excellence in the halotherapy industry.

Each day, the symposium will kick off at 10AM (EST) and journey through a schedule packed with a host of global industry figures for live keynotes, panel discussions and immersive wellness experiences.

The speaker line-up features:
• Annie Hood, wellness business advisor and chief executive of Well Intelligence.
• Ann Brown, CEO and founder of Saltability.
• Amy McDonald, CEO and founder of Under a Tree Wellness Consulting.
• Daniella Russell, managing director of Daniella Russell Harper DRG Project Management Services.
• Kathryn Moore, founder and managing director of Spa Connectors.
• Michelle Hammond, lead consultant of Wellness Curated and founder of tpot: the power of touch.
• Paula Perkins, CEO of Paula Perkins Spa Consultancy
• Tammy Pahel, VP of spa and wellness operations at Carillon Miami Wellness Resort.
• Steve Spiro, founder, CEO and managing partner of Halotherapy Solutions and chair of Global Wellness Institute’s Salt & Halotherapy Initiative.

Attendees will also have the opportunity to virtually network with one another and visit virtual expo booths.

Erin Lee, WHA executive director, told Spa Business: "My goal for the symposium is to help halotherapy become recognised across the globe by as many people as possible.

"I wholeheartedly believe in its many benefits and the positive impact it can play in preventative health, general wellbeing and recovery from illnesses.

"I hope as a result of the event we'll take a big step forward together and see and show how halotherapy can play a huge part in the world of wellbeing and living well."

Following the event, all WHA members will have access to recordings from the symposium.
